ofbiz-component.xml

Clone Tools
  • last updated a few minutes 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Improved: Convert PartyStatusChangeTests.xml to Groovy (OFBIZ-11853)

  1. … 4 more files in changeset.
Reverted: "Improved: Use ‘depends-on’ attribute instead of “component-load.xml”" (OFBIZ-11296)

This reverts commit eeabe69813a1d9f42911dec70a912574046ef49b.

  1. … 24 more files in changeset.
Improved: Use ‘depends-on’ attribute instead of “component-load.xml” (OFBIZ-11296)

We currently have two ways to define component loading order. Either

by using ‘depends-on’ attribute in “component-config.xml” or by adding

a “component-load.xml” file at the root of a component directory.

“depends-on” is more flexible because it handles partial ordering when

“component-load.xml” defines a total order which is not necessarily

meaningful, so it is better to rely only “depends-on”.

This removes the usage of “component-load.xml” to use ‘depends-on’

instead. The dependency declarations correspond to the total ordering

previously defined but will need to be refined in the future to relax

unnecessary dependency declarations.

Only “framework/base/config/component-load.xml” which defines the

top-level directories order (framework, applications, themes and

plugins) is kept.

  1. … 24 more files in changeset.
Improved: Move all data in applications to the datamodel component. Move the PortalPortlet, PortletPortletCategory and PortletCategory data to party, workeffort and content components from datamodel. (OFBIZ-9501) Thanks to Taher for reporting.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/ofbiz-framework/trunk@1828817 13f79535-47bb-0310-9956-ffa450edef68

  1. … 9 more files in changeset.
Improved: Move all data in applications to the datamodel component. Moved demo data from accounting, commonext, content, humanres, manufacturing, marketing, order, party, product, workeffort components to datamodel component. Done changes in related data files and do entries accordingly. (OFBIZ-9501) Thanks to Sourabh Jain for your contribution.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/ofbiz-framework/trunk@1823177 13f79535-47bb-0310-9956-ffa450edef68

  1. … 69 more files in changeset.
Improved: Move all data in applications to the datamodel component. Moved seed and seed-initial data from party, content, security ext and work effort component. Left with few data changes which can be moved to some plugins or confusing. Will share the data over community and proceed accordingly once base effort is complete. Thanks Sourabh Jain, Saurabh Dixit and Prakhar Kumar for your contribution. (OFBIZ-9501)

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/ofbiz-framework/trunk@1813724 13f79535-47bb-0310-9956-ffa450edef68

  1. … 30 more files in changeset.
Improved: Removed deprecated entities. (OFBIZ-9327)

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/ofbiz-framework/trunk@1792176 13f79535-47bb-0310-9956-ffa450edef68

  1. … 10 more files in changeset.
Implemented: Added CRUD services for PartyClassificationType, PartyContentType, PartyGeoPoint, PartyIcsAvsOverride, PartyIdentificationType, PartyQualType, PartyType, PartyTypeAttr, PaymentAttribute, PaymentBudgetAllocation, PaymentContentType, PaymentGroupType, PaymentMethodType, PaymentType, PaymentTypeAttr, PerfRatingType, PerfReviewItemType, PeriodType, PriorityType and ProdCatalogCategoryType entities.

(OFBIZ-8606)(OFBIZ-8607)(OFBIZ-8608)(OFBIZ-8609)(OFBIZ-8610)(OFBIZ-8611)(OFBIZ-8612)(OFBIZ-8613)(OFBIZ-8614)(OFBIZ-8615)(OFBIZ-8616)(OFBIZ-8647)(OFBIZ-8648)(OFBIZ-8649)(OFBIZ-8650)(OFBIZ-8651)(OFBIZ-8724)

(OFBIZ-8725)(OFBIZ-8726)(OFBIZ-8727)

Thanks: Amit Gadaley and Rishi Solanki for the contribution.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1767953 13f79535-47bb-0310-9956-ffa450edef68

  1. … 7 more files in changeset.
Applied patch from jira issue - OFBIZ-8060 - Added CRUD services for ContactMechPurposeType entity . Thanks Amit Gadaley and Rishi Solanki for your contribution.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1759099 13f79535-47bb-0310-9956-ffa450edef68

  1. … 1 more file in changeset.
Applied patch from jira issue - OFBIZ-8047 - Added CRUD services for CommunicationEventType entity . Thanks Amit Gadaley and Rishi Solanki for your contribution.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1759097 13f79535-47bb-0310-9956-ffa450edef68

  1. … 1 more file in changeset.
Applied patch from jira issue - OFBIZ-7861 - Added CRUD services for AgreementItemType entity . Thanks Amit Gadaley for your contribution.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1758614 13f79535-47bb-0310-9956-ffa450edef68

  1. … 1 more file in changeset.
Fixes "Remove warnings regarding missing component lib folders" - https://issues.apache.org/jira/browse/OFBIZ-7776 - by cleaning/clearing the references to non existent/empty dirs.

Notes:

* Also removes empty framework/base/lib/scripting and useless applications\content\lib\uno\README (miss doc in wiki)

* When jpim-0.1.jar will be (hopefully) replaced we can drop lib ref in framework/base/ofbiz-component.xml

* I wonder if we should let the geronimo component alone with only 2 classes, could we not put that in entity or entityext?

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1755306 13f79535-47bb-0310-9956-ffa450edef68

  1. … 45 more files in changeset.
OFBIZ-6760: Moved all entity definitions from the applications components into a new component named "datamodel". This is a first step to refactor application components into independent parts that can be deployed when needed.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1720413 13f79535-47bb-0310-9956-ffa450edef68

  1. … 30 more files in changeset.
split up securitypermissions as seed data and securitygroups as demo data with a single exception: the creation of a super security group which has general access to the system and which is used with the 'ant create-admin-user-login' command.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1352431 13f79535-47bb-0310-9956-ffa450edef68

  1. … 126 more files in changeset.
reverted recent security file changes revisions: 1350847,1350843,1350840,1348534,1347908,1347213,1346264, need more investigation

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1351206 13f79535-47bb-0310-9956-ffa450edef68

  1. … 42 more files in changeset.
introduced a new data-reader : 'security'

Security is now by default not loaded because not part of seed anymore this will make all component hidden and not accessible .

It is still loaded as part of the reader 'demo'

to load the security files:

./ant load-readers -Ddata-readers=security

Now it is possible to load only a selection of the security files in your hot-deploy component as follows:

<entity-resource type=data reader-name=seed loader=main location=../../framework/security/data/SecurityData.xml/>

<entity-resource type=data reader-name=seed loader=main location=../../framework/webtools/data/WebtoolsSecurityData.xml/>

<entity-resource type=data reader-name=seed loader=main location=../../applications/party/data/PartySecurityData.xml/>

This will enable only standard groups, the party and the webtools application.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1346255 13f79535-47bb-0310-9956-ffa450edef68

  1. … 34 more files in changeset.
OFBIZ-4643 - Add description for Component, only complete existing functionality - a patch from Olivier Heintz

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@1226954 13f79535-47bb-0310-9956-ffa450edef68

  1. … 3 more files in changeset.
Moved various test case related to party contact mechanism to a separate file.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@906422 13f79535-47bb-0310-9956-ffa450edef68

  1. … 3 more files in changeset.
Renamed AgreementWorkEffortAppl entity to AgreementWorkEffortApplic in order to change relation types so that assigning WorkEfforts to Agreements is possible w/o specifying an agreementItemSeqId. Added a migrateAgreementWorkEffortAppl service to migrate existing data to the new entity.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@883140 13f79535-47bb-0310-9956-ffa450edef68

  1. … 16 more files in changeset.
moved temporary the party helpfile to the content component until solution is found because the party component is loaded first and need the content component (as reported on the mailing list)

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@814546 13f79535-47bb-0310-9956-ffa450edef68

  1. … 3 more files in changeset.
helpscreens placeholders now converted to the docbook V5 format inclusive of namespace support, updated the apache ofbiz document to explain how to create helpscreens, created an ftl template to display the docbook help screens, docbook pdf generation now almost working: it can create a local pdf file, but streaming to the browser does not work..if anybody interested to help me check modelscreenwidget.java line 1206

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@811787 13f79535-47bb-0310-9956-ffa450edef68

  1. … 30 more files in changeset.
move myportal demo data into the related components

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@779048 13f79535-47bb-0310-9956-ffa450edef68

  1. … 5 more files in changeset.
implemented service to process bounced emails and update the communication event status

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@772780 13f79535-47bb-0310-9956-ffa450edef68

  1. … 3 more files in changeset.
As suggested by David, these lines are not needed anymore

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@771090 13f79535-47bb-0310-9956-ffa450edef68

  1. … 19 more files in changeset.
2d part and end of an effort to remove trailing spaces [ \t]+$ => "" (empty) Should be easier to review when committing changes with trailing spaces removed automatically by anyedit or such tool (please refer to http://docs.ofbiz.org/x/mg)

Of course this effort to remove trailing spaces has no functional implications.

Actually, I was doing a 1st commit and as it's long to upload, I got conflicts with r763135

In the meantime I did some refactoring also in *.java and *.groovy files :

){ => ) {

if( => if (

while( => while (

}else => } else

else{ => else {

switch( => switch (

try{ => try {

}catch => } catch

catch( => catch (

}finally{ => } finally {

So these changes are also in this commit, should not be a problem anyway.

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@763175 13f79535-47bb-0310-9956-ffa450edef68

  1. … 2212 more files in changeset.
move of the first portlet from myportal to the original party component

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@750805 13f79535-47bb-0310-9956-ffa450edef68

  1. … 6 more files in changeset.
A 1st commit for "Add geolocation to data model" (https://issues.apache.org/jira/browse/OFBIZ-1923) OFBIZ-1923

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@735404 13f79535-47bb-0310-9956-ffa450edef68

  1. … 16 more files in changeset.
Move scheduled service data back to seed-initial

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@733636 13f79535-47bb-0310-9956-ffa450edef68

change sheduled jobs to seed data

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@733624 13f79535-47bb-0310-9956-ffa450edef68

sheduled jobs should only load at initial load time otherwise they are duplicated at every seed load

git-svn-id: https://svn.apache.org/repos/asf/ofbiz/trunk@685412 13f79535-47bb-0310-9956-ffa450edef68